Output e5a1ddbd78a6d01565fe49473fa4451622a099968327ff6c3baaf4a88964d771:1

value
307545605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8189ff33a4f7dc143733e6ff5d8e53f6bfa247e OP_EQUALVERIFY OP_CHECKSIG
address
1KF1eKzqe5aEXAwAYZ7y5A1bsBzzXbbq64
transaction
e5a1ddbd78a6d01565fe49473fa4451622a099968327ff6c3baaf4a88964d771
spent
true